The B2B Lead blog has a story today (April 1) about Google announcing a partnership with Linden Lab (or as they put it ‘Labs’). Apparently Google as set to become the premier advertising medium in SL with a ‘two-pronged’ approach:

‘Code-named Narnia, the agreement details a two-pronged advertising strategy that will enable Googles PPC-based AdWords technology to be ascribed to any assets within Second Life, including the Avatars themselves. The second and most interesting component of the agreement provides for the ability to bridge PPC advertisements and landing page interactivity between the real world and Second Life. Imagine an Adwords-enabled billboard in Second Life promoting a new sports car that, when clicked on, draws the user back onto the advertisers web site on the Internet, and vice versa.’

Nice try boys. Next time, at least get the company name right.
